Agenda for 2011
We plan to begin our program at 11:00 AM on Friday, November 4 and close at 12:30 PM Saturday, November 5. This arrangement accommodates the increased continuing medical education units and also allows for free time to enjoy St. Louis and the Four Seasons accommodations.
